A uniform magnetic field of induction B is confined to a cylindriacal region of radius R. The magnetic field is increasing at a constant rate of `(Db)/(dt)). Am electron of charge e, placed at the point P on the preriphery of the field experiences accceleration.

A

`1/2(eR)/m(dB)/(dt)` toward left

B

`1/2(eR)/m(dB)/(dt)` toward right

C

`(eR)/m(dB)/(dt)` toward left

D

zero

Text Solution

Verified by Experts

The correct Answer is:
A

`a=(qE)/m=1/2(eR)/m(dB)/(dt)`.towards left
